Accommodations 221
beautifully renovated guest
rooms and suites feature a
cozy gas fireplace,
microwave, refrigerator, wet
bar and a private balcony or
patio. Many rooms provide
views of the stunning Red
Rock formations Sedona is
famous for or perfectly
manicured golf course
fairways. Deluxe Guest
Rooms, One-Bedroom Guest
Suites, Premium Suites,
ADA Accessible Guest
Rooms or Jacuzzi Suites are
available. Guest rooms were
renovated in spring 2015 as
part of a $7 million renovation.
Amenities
eforea: spa at Hilton Home to the first eforea: spa at Hilton in
the Western U.S., the resort offers 25,000 square-feet of
wellness, fitness and spa amenities including 9 treatment
rooms, a 25-meter heated lap pool, steam rooms and saunas,
fully equipped Precor circuit fitness center, three lighted tennis
courts and unlimited complimentary fitness classes from Tai Chi
and Qi Gong to yoga and pilates. A unique treatment menu of
wellness-based experiences well-known to Sedona with some
therapies exclusive only to eforea: spa at Hilton is available.
The Outdoor Warrior Pit In 2016 the
resort completed its newest fitness facility,
the Outdoor Warrior Pit. The one-of-a-kind
boot camp playground is the only cross
training resort facility in the South West.
Equipped with tires, ropes, sledge
hammers and anchors, resort guests can
exercise at their leisure or attend one of the
weekly classes led by seasoned
instructors.
The Living Room As part of the $7 million renovation completed in spring 2015, the resort’s new 6,480
square-foot lobby offers a respite from the moment you enter the resort. In the center, a suspended sculpture
swirls above a patch of green grass and a river of icy blue crystals symbolic of the rose quartz found in the
region and the tranquility of nearby Oak Creek. Elements of relaxation continue into The Living Room, a 4,875
square-foot gathering space outfitted with comfortable couches, chairs, a fireplace and a community table –
featuring a design that captures Arizona’s vagabond spirit and Western heritage.

Dining
ShadowRock Tap + Table The resort completed a $2.4 million restaurant transformation at the beginning of
2018. The redesign provides refined yet relaxed gathering spaces tailored for the modern traveler. Serving
locally sourced fare, the restaurant celebrates Sedona’s southwestern traditions with a fresh, flavorful twist led
by Executive Chef Jason Flores.
ShadowRock Tap +
Table features 11,500
square feet of indoor and
outdoor spaces merging
together as one through
large accordion doors
that bring in light, energy
and ambiance. Sedona’s
colorful landscape
trickles in through a
blend of natural woods,
metals and warm earth
tones, creating a
seamless transition from
the inside to “The
Porch”, the restaurant’s
expansive outdoor patio.
Designed to inspire
conversation and a
vibrant atmosphere that celebrates the Red Rock spirit of adventure, the Porch is as fun as it is inviting.
At the center of the action is a 27-seat rectangular bar that serves a variety of local craft beers, specialty
Sedona cocktails and a full menu. Featuring four large fire pits, scenic seating and water features, ping pong,
corn hole, shuffleboard, foosball and more, ShadowRock Tap + Table is the vibrant village spot where
travelers can kick back, relax and cheers with locals.
